HOTALING v. CITY OF NEW YORK


55 A.D.3d 396 (2008)

866 N.Y.S.2d 117

CHRISTOPHER HOTALING et al., Respondents-Appellants, v. CITY OF NEW YORK et al., Appellants-Respondents.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

October 21, 2008.


Plaintiff Christopher Hotaling was severely injured while employed as a guidance counselor at Martin Luther King, Jr. High School in Manhattan, when he was hit in the head with a door while in the process of exiting the building for a fire drill.
